- BVN can be received free-to-air, 24 hours a day in Western and Central Europe with a digital satellite receiver via the ASTRA 1 satellite on 19.2 degrees east.
- A second option in Europe is reception via the Eutelsat Hotbird satellite.
- In these regions all you need is a modern free-to-air (FTA) DVB receiver and a good quality satellite dish.
- The size of dish required will depend on where you intend to receive BVN. The correct size of satellite dish is extremely important for good interference-free reception.
- Our broadcasts are listed under BVN in the Electronic Programme Guide (EPG).
